Next General Up
By Master Sgt. Charles Johnston | June 10, 2026
The New Hampshire Air National Guard has a new commander after a change of command ceremony June 7 at Pease Air National Guard Base in Newington. Hundreds of troops and civilian guests filled a base hangar for the promotion of Brig. Gen. Brian Jusseaume and his assumption of command against the backdrop of a KC-46A Pegasus.

Building Trust Through Shared Expertise
By SSgt Elliot Boutin | May 29, 2026
A joint New Hampshire National Guard medical team conducted an aeromedical exchange with its state partners in Praia, Cabo Verde from May 20 to 22.
